Ingredients
-
1 lb boneless sk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
-
1 lb potato gnocchi
-
6 cloves garlic, minced
-
1 cup heavy cream
-
1 cup chicken broth
-
½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
-
2 tablespoons olive oil
-
1 teaspoon dried Italian herbs
-
Salt, to taste
-
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
-
Fresh basil leaves, for garnish
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paring the Ingredients
Start by cutting the chicken breasts into even bite-sized pieces. This helps them cook quickly and evenly, which keeps this dish a true 30 minute meal. Mince the garlic finely so it blends smoothly into the sauce instead of overpowering individual bites.
Measure out the cream, broth, and Parmesan ahead of time. Because this is a one pan chicken recipe, everything moves quickly once the skillet heats up. Having ingredients ready keeps the cooking process smooth and stress-free.
Cooking Instructions
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the chicken pieces and season them with salt, pepper, and dried Italian herbs. Cook for 6 to 8 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the chicken turns golden brown and cooks through.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set it aside.
In the same skillet, add the minced garlic. S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ant. Stir constantly so it does not burn.
Pour in the chicken broth and scrape up any browned bits from the bottom of the skillet using a wooden spoon. This step adds depth to the creamy gnocchi sauce.
Add the gnocchi directly to the skillet and bring the mixture to a gentle simmer. Cook for 3 to 4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the gnocchi begins to soften.
Reduce the heat to medium-low. Pour in the heavy cream and stir gently. Let the sauce simmer for 2 to 3 minutes until it thickens slightly.
Return the cooked chicken to the skillet. Add the grated Parmesan cheese and stir until the cheese melts completely and the chicken heats through.
Taste and adjust seasoning with additional salt and pepper if needed. Garnish with fresh basil before serving.
Tips for Perfect Results
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Avoid overcrowding the pan when browning the chicken. If the pieces sit too close together, they steam instead of sear, which reduces flavor. Cook in batches if necessary.
Do not overcook the gnocchi. Once it becomes tender, move to the next step. Overcooked gnocchi can turn soft and lose its pleasant texture.
Also, keep the heat moderate after adding cream. High heat can cause the sauce to separate instead of thicken smoothly.
Pro Tips for Better Flavor
For deeper flavor, use freshly grated Parmesan rather than pre-shredded cheese. Fresh cheese melts better and creates a smoother sauce.
If you enjoy extra richness, stir in a small knob of butter at the end. For added freshness, finish with a squeeze of lemon juice to brighten the creamy sauce.
You can also add spinach or sun-dried tomatoes for variation. Both pair beautifully with this comfort food skillet and add color as well as texture.
Serving and Storage
How to Serve
Serve Garlic Chicken Gnocchi immediately while the sauce remains creamy and smooth. Because this dish is rich, pair it with a crisp green salad or roasted vegetables for balance.
A slice of crusty bread works well for soaking up the extra sauce. If you want to elevate presentation, sprinkle additional Parmesan and fresh basil on top just before serving.
How to Store Leftovers
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. The sauce will thicken as it cools.
When reheating, add a splash of milk or chicken broth to loosen the sauce. Warm gently over medium-low heat, stirring frequently to restore the creamy texture.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use store-bought gnocchi?
Yes, shelf-stable or refrigerated potato gnocchi both work perfectly in this recipe. Simply add them directly to the skillet as directed.
Can I make this recipe lighter?
You can substitute half-and-half or whole milk for heavy cream. The sauce will be thinner but still flavorful.
Can I make this gluten free?
Many grocery stores offer gluten-free gnocchi made from alternative flours. Just check the packaging and follow the same cooking instructions.
